Thorncrown Chapel is a chapel located in Eureka Springs, Arkansas – designed by E. Fay Jones and constructed in 1980. The design recalls Prairie School architecture – popularized by Frank Lloyd Wright, with whom Jones had apprenticed and was commissioned by Jim Reed, a retired schoolteacher. Then there may be a little bit of a dirt path but it is mostly like a flagstone path. I just checked my picture ...Thorncrown Chapel is 48 feet tall and comprises 425 windows. In fact, Thorncrown is composed of more than 6,000 sq. ft. of glass between the members of its wood frame. Situated on flagstone floors, it sits on top of 100 tons of native stone. Fay Jones. Photograph by Randall Connaughton About Us. Thorncrown was the dream of Jim Reed, a native of Pine Bluff, Arkansas. In 1971 Jim purchased the land which is now the site of the chapel to build his retirement home. However, other people admired his location and would often stop at his property to gain a better view of the beautiful Ozark hills. A few days later, a woman from Illinois provided a loan that allowed Jim to complete his dream and in the summer of 1980, the chapel opened. Thorncrown chapel stands 48 feet tall with over 6,000 square feet of glass and a total of 425 windows. The foundation is over 100 tons of native stone & colored flagstone, making it blend in with the rocky ...This is an image of a place or building that is listed on the National Register of Historic Places in the United States of America.
